On Fri, Aug 07, 2026 at 12:22:37PM +0200, Rafael J. Wysocki wrote:

> If acpi_dev_get_resources() returns overlapping I/O or memory resources,
> the subsequent registration of a platform device will fail with -EBUSY
> due to a resource conflict.  This is reported to happen on Acer Aspire
> ES1-572 [1].
> 
> Avoid that by adjusting resources returned by acpi_dev_get_resources()
> to eliminate partial overlaps between them.
> 
> This has not been regarded as necessary before because putting
> overlapping resources into the _CRS of one device is really pointless,
> but now that the issue has been reported to actually happen in the
> field, it needs to be done.
